From c3ec52e392107e9e735c1a4975b9fe3407401274 Mon Sep 17 00:00:00 2001 From: naiba Date: Sat, 15 Mar 2025 22:31:16 +0800 Subject: [PATCH] feat: upgrade frontend --- cmd/dashboard/controller/oauth2.go | 6 ++---- service/singleton/frontend-templates.yaml | 2 +- 2 files changed, 3 insertions(+), 5 deletions(-) diff --git a/cmd/dashboard/controller/oauth2.go b/cmd/dashboard/controller/oauth2.go index a9faab0..49bd900 100644 --- a/cmd/dashboard/controller/oauth2.go +++ b/cmd/dashboard/controller/oauth2.go @@ -1,7 +1,6 @@ package controller import ( - "context" "fmt" "io" "net/http" @@ -193,13 +192,12 @@ func oauth2callback(jwtConfig *jwt.GinJWTMiddleware) func(c *gin.Context) (any, func exchangeOpenId(c *gin.Context, o2confRaw *model.Oauth2Config, callbackData *model.Oauth2Callback, redirectURL string) (string, error) { o2conf := o2confRaw.Setup(redirectURL) - ctx := context.Background() - otk, err := o2conf.Exchange(ctx, callbackData.Code) + otk, err := o2conf.Exchange(c, callbackData.Code) if err != nil { return "", err } - oauth2client := o2conf.Client(ctx, otk) + oauth2client := o2conf.Client(c, otk) resp, err := oauth2client.Get(o2confRaw.UserInfoURL) if err != nil { return "", err diff --git a/service/singleton/frontend-templates.yaml b/service/singleton/frontend-templates.yaml index 864d5b0..2a98d93 100644 --- a/service/singleton/frontend-templates.yaml +++ b/service/singleton/frontend-templates.yaml @@ -9,7 +9,7 @@ name: "Official" repository: "https://github.com/hamster1963/nezha-dash-v1" author: "hamster1963" - version: "v1.23.0" + version: "v1.24.0" is_official: true - path: "nezha-ascii-dist" name: "Nezha-ASCII"